Knollwood, Greek Revival residence on Bearden Hill, Tennessee, US.
Knollwood showcases white columns and symmetrical windows across its facade, standing at the highest point of Bearden Hill in Knoxville.
Built in 1851 by Robert Reynolds, the residence served as headquarters for Confederate General James Longstreet during the siege of Knoxville in 1863.
The property represents the architectural evolution of Knoxville's antebellum mansions, combining Federal style with later Neoclassical modifications.
Currently functioning as the headquarters for Schaad Companies, the building maintains its historical features while accommodating modern office requirements.
The house renovation earned two awards for successfully integrating original elements like staircases and plaster walls with contemporary business needs.
